    摘要: The present invention detects a computer virus at high speed from digital data acquired through a network using hardware in virus monitoring. With the invention, in an information processing terminal 002 capable of communicating with other information processing apparatus through a communication network 005, a virus checking apparatus 001 constructed of a hardware circuit is disposed in the side of an input channel of the network 005 and a virus is checked from input data from the network 005 by the virus checking apparatus 001. In order to change a virus pattern collated with the input data by hardware, the hardware circuit is detachably mounted or a rewritable logic device is used in the hardware circuit. The virus pattern of the logic device can be rewritten by sending virus definition information of a server 004 or control data generated based on this information to the virus checking apparatus 001.

    摘要: A network system by the present invention can quickly detect viruses and does not easily become a new cause of vulnerability. A packet data comparator branches inputted packet data into three branches, and includes an additional pattern matching unit which compares the branched data with the stored data and performs matching with collation patterns stored in a rewritable storage area, a fixed pattern matching unit which compares the branched data with the stored data and performs the matching with a logical operation configured with known collation patterns, a notification packet matching unit which compares the branched data with the stored data and finds a notification packet, and an identity detection aggregation unit which aggregates results from the respective matching units. Moreover, a virus filter, a virus checker, and a secure network system are realized by using the present invention.

    摘要: A digital system that performs a specified function by performing digital processing according to one or more clock signals is provided with a plurality of delay elements which are respectively inserted in a plurality of clock circuits that supply the clock signals in the digital system and each of which is composed of a circuit element that changes a delay time according to a value indicated by a control signal, and a plurality of holding circuits that hold a plurality of control signals to be given to the plurality of delay elements. In the plurality of holding circuits, a value of the control signals held by these holding circuits is changed by external devices according to a probabilistic search technique so that the digital system operates correctly in relation to operation timing.

    摘要: A novel fluorescent substance for a light-emitting diode, emitting light of any one of three primary colors by excitation of an ultraviolet light-emitting diode. Alternatively, a novel fluorescent substance for a light-emitting diode, emitting light in a red region of a spectrum by excitation of a blue light-emitting diode. Na2SrSi2O6 is doped with Eu3+. Preferably, Eu3+ is added so as to account for 1 to 80 mol % in concentration in a host crystal, while sites of Si4+ in Na2SrSi2O6. are replaced by Al3+ and/or Ga3+. Alternatively, Ca3Si2O7 is doped with Ce3+ and Tb3+. Preferably, Ce3+ and Tb3+ are added so as to account for 0.1 to 80 mol % and 0.1 to 20 mol % in concentration in a host crystal, respectively. Still alternatively, Ca3Si2O7 is doped with Eu2+. Preferably, Eu2+ is added so as to account for 0.5 to 10 mol % in concentration in the host crystal.

    摘要: A CRC value calculator enables throughput to be improved while keeping down the increase in the size of the circuitry. This is achieved by using (n+1) basic CRC circuits to configure a CRC value calculator in which the width of the data processed during one clock cycle is m2n bits. For example, when m2n bits is the data width processed per calculator cycle, the CRC value calculator of this invention is configured by using selectors to serially connect a CRC circuit that processes every m2n bits, a CRC circuit that processes every m2(n−1) bits, . . . , and a CRC circuit that processes every m20 bits. This configuration makes it possible to calculate a correct CRC value even when the remainder of an input network frame is not a multiple of m2n bits. Selectors are used to select CRC circuit output according to process data width. Reduction of the operating frequency is avoided by using registers to form a pipeline between CRC circuits.

    摘要: An etchant for copper and copper alloys, includes an aqueous solution containing: 14 to 155 g/liter of cupric ion source in terms of a concentration of copper ions; 7 to 180 g/liter of hydrochloric acid; and 0.1 to 50 g/liter of azole, the azole including nitrogen atoms only as heteroatoms residing in a ring. A method for producing a wiring by etching of copper or copper alloys, includes the step of: etching a portion of a copper layer on an electrical insulative member that is not covered with an etching resist using the above-described etchant so as to form the wiring. Thereby, a fine and dense wiring pattern with reduced undercut can be formed.

    摘要: A clutch can comprise driving clutch plates spline-fitted on an input member, driven clutch plates arranged alternately with the driving clutch plates and spline-fitted on an output member, a clutch piston having one surface facing an oil pressure chamber and another surface facing the clutch plates and adapted to be displaced toward the plates by supplying oil to the oil pressure chamber and to be returned by discharging the oil from the chamber. A valve can pass through the clutch piston and be adapted to be closed for preventing oil from exiting the chamber to the other side of the clutch piston when the clutch is clutched-on and to be opened and allow airflow to the oil pressure chamber when the clutch is clutched-off. One or more weight reduction recesses can be formed on one surface of the clutch piston near the outer circumference further radially outward than the valve.
